Summary

Real Madrid is in pursuit of Ayyoub Bouaddi, a young midfielder from Lille, as interest grows from several top European clubs including Manchester City, Manchester United, Arsenal, and Bayern Munich. The midfielder's standout performances for Morocco during the World Cup have elevated his status, leading to a crowded transfer market. Lille is reportedly demanding between €80 million and €100 million for Bouaddi, who is under contract until 2029, strengthening Lille's negotiating position. The club is also open to a deal that would see Bouaddi loaned back to them after a transfer, allowing him to continue developing.
